I'm not sure that applies here, where there are multiple titles to cause obfuscation.

The 800 vs. 801, 802, 803 are usually when there are different language graphics on some producer's titles (Disney is one, I think). 800 is usually the English version. And this applies to 1080p titles, also.

Re: Dirty Dancing SteelBook Best Buy 4K UHD

Posted: Sun May 02, 2021 11:28 am
by PiratesRus
Studio put bad files and bad playlists on disc on purpose.

182 playlists, yeah

playlist must not include 502 and 503, as bad files...

Try something like 00706.mpls

Re: Dirty Dancing SteelBook Best Buy 4K UHD

Posted: Sun May 02, 2021 11:32 am
by PiratesRus
correction, 501 and 502 are the bad files that do not belong in playlist

Re: Dirty Dancing SteelBook Best Buy 4K UHD

Posted: Sun May 02, 2021 3:26 pm
by Balthazar2k4
After manually reviewing the M2TS files the correct playlist for my copy is 706.

Segment list: 505 + 507 + 500 + 504 + 503 + 506 + 509
